Stocks to Watch: IBM, AXP, QCOM & More
CNBC.com | July 18, 2012 | 04:41 PM EDT

Check out which companies are making headlines after the bell Wednesday:

Pershing Square Capital Management's William Ackman, told investors in a letter that it sold its Citigroup shares to help build a stake in Procter & Gamble . Ackman told CNBC his fund owns about $1.8 billion dollars worth of stock in P&G.(Click here for after-hours quotes.)

Microsoft - The software giant announced its new Windows 8 will be released on October 26. Shares edged higher in extended-hours trading. (Click here for extended-hours quote.)

IBM - The tech giant posted earnings of $3.51 a share, topping expectations for $3.42 a share. But the company posted revenue of $25.8 billion, missing Wall Street's expectations for $26.28 billion.Still, the company also raised its full-year earnings outlook , sending shares higher in after-hours trading. American Express - Thecredit-card provider posted earnings of $1.15 a share, beating expectations for $1.09 a share. But the firm reported sales of $7.97 billion, below estimates for $8.1 billion. Shares edged lower in extended-hours trading. (Click here for extended-hours quote.)
